February 1976: The first CIS call is taken (Florida)
Mid-1980s: CIS begins using Physician Data Query, NCI's comprehensive cancer database; the Publications Ordering Service is launched; e-mail is introduced into day-to-day operations; and CIS launches a community outreach component
2000: Smoking cessation call centers become a permanent service
2002: The NCI Smoking Quitline number,1-877-44U-QUIT, is implemented |
|
2004: In accordance with the National Network of Tobacco Cessation Quitlines Initiative, 1-800-QUITNOW is established
2005: CIS is awarded 15 base contracts to operate the CIS Partnership Program, and 4 of those contracts are also awarded call centers
